How to Shut off Your Water When Pipe's Burst
You have to recognize just how to switch off your main water line if you suffer from a burst pipeline. Don't wait on a plumbing emergency before learning how to get this done. Besides, other than emergency leakages, you will require to switch off your primary water shutoff for plumbing repairs or if you leave for a lengthy journey. Where is This Primary Valve Situated?


The major water line supply can differ, so you may require to find time to figure out where it is. Unfortunately, when your home is getting soaked due to a ruptured pipe, you don't have the luxury of time during an emergency. Thus, you need to prepare for this plumbing situation by learning where the valve lies.
This shutoff valve could appear like a round valve (with a lever-type deal with) or a gate shutoff (with a circle faucet). Placement relies on the age of your residence and also the environment in your area. Inspect the following common areas:
  • Inside of Residence: In colder environments, the city supply pipes face your house. Inspect typical utility locations like your cellar, laundry room, or garage. A likely area is near the water heater. In the basement, this valve will go to your eye degree. On the other main floors, you might need to bend down to discover it.

  • Outdoors on the Exterior Wall: The major valve is outside the home in tropical climates where they don't experience wintertime. It is typically linked to an outside wall surface. Check for it near an outdoor tap.

  • Outdoors by the Street: If you can't discover the valve anywhere else, it is time to examine your street. It could be outdoors alongside your water meter. It could be below the accessibility panel near the ground on your street. You might need a meter secret that's sold in equipment shops to take off the panel cover. You can discover 2 shutoffs, one for city use and one for your residence. Make certain you shut off the appropriate one. And also you will certainly recognize that you did when none of the faucets in your house launch freshwater.


  • What to Do When a Pipe Bursts in Your Home


    A burst pipe is one of a homeowner's worst nightmares. Not knowing the signs and being unprepared for this plumbing issue can result in more water damage and clean up. Here are the warning signs of a pipe about to burst and the steps you can take if it happens.


    Warning Signs for Burst Pipes


  • Rusty, discolored water with a bad smell


  • Puddles under your sinks


  • Abrupt changes in water pressure


  • A spike in your water bill


  • Clanging noises coming from pipes behind the walls


  • What to Do When a Pipe Bursts


    Turn off your water. The sooner you do this, the better. Shutting off your main valve will help minimize the damage to your home.



    Drain the faucets. After the water has been turned off, drain the remaining water by opening your faucets. Doing so will help prevent areas from freezing and also relieve pressure within your pipe system to avoid more bursts.



    Locate the burst pipe. Look for bulging ceilings, warping and other signs of where the water damage has occurred. Once you locate the pipe, you will be able to determine if it is a small crack that can be patched or a major repair that needs to be dealt with right away.



    Call a professional. If you need significant repairs, contact a professional to come in as soon as possible. At Mr. Rooter Plumbing of Oneida, we offer 24/7 emergency service for your convenience.



    Document the damage. If you have extensive pipe damage, be sure to take photos of the affected areas so you can document a claim with your insurance. Take close-up photos of the damage and use a measuring tape to show how high the water is. You should also take photos from different angles for a wider picture of the affected areas.



    Start cleaning. After you have documented the damage, start cleaning up the water as soon as possible. The longer the water sits, the higher the chance that mold will develop.
